PRODUCT INFORMATION:

Super strong magnet - max. 55kg holding force!

With a diameter of 125 mm and a holding force of up to 55 kg, it is a real powerhouse! The magnet is round, rubberised and has an all-round rubber lip as well as a practical release tab that makes it easy to remove. Depending on the version, equipped with an internal or external M6x19mm thread, it offers versatile fastening options.

NdFeB magnetic system, black rubber sheath, external thread, with sealing lip and detachable tab, ø 125 mm

Article number: AS125NdAG06s-00
D mm: 125 +2/-2
H mm: 8,5
Adhesive force* N: 550
Weight g: 204
Temperature °C: 80
Surface: black
Thread MxL: M6x20

* The forces have been determined at room temperature on a polished plate made of steel (S235JR according to DIN 10 025) with a thickness of 10 mm (1kg~10N). A deviation of up to -10% from the specified value is possible in exceptional cases. In general, the value is exceeded. The type of application (installation situation, temperatures, counter anchors, etc.) sometimes influence the forces enormously. The values given are for orientation purposes.
